Brief history/background of Jazz music
Jazz is a popular music genre all over the world. Jazz stands out because of its unique swing, blue notes, polyrhythms, improvisation as well as call and response vocals. Jazz music has been popular since the late 19th century. The music can be traced back to African American communities living in New Orleans back in the late 1800s. The genre has African roots in West African culture as well as African-American music traditions like blues and ragtime. Jazz music also has European military band music preferences.
Although Jazz music is greatly influenced by the experiences of African Americans in the United States, different cultures globally have contributed their own unique experiences and styles to the genre resulting in many distinctive Jazz styles.
